Who is your style icon? What is your favourite item of clothing and why? What could you bring to our store? What did you learn from your previous job? why did you leave your previous job? They didn't ask that many personal questions. I had a phone interview before the one on one interview, where they asked about my availability, skills, if the hours of the contract suited me etc. The manager also asked me if I had any questions so it would be a good idea if you have a few questions prepared. I asked what it was like to work in Gap and he said he loved it but there are good days and bad days. Great experience overall. Required an application submitted online. It was straightforward and easy to fill out with a picture quiz of different situations that may happen on the floor and how you would handle them. Once I submitted that, I was asked to come in for a group interview with other candidates. Once I passed that step, I met with the General Manager.
